ROAD CYCLING RACE
SYDNEY TO MELBOURNE. United Press Association —By Electric Telegraph Copyright.) Received 12.30 p.m., to-day. SYDNEY, Oct. 24. After a day’s rest at Wagga the Sydnew to Melbourne cyclists completed the third stage to Albany. There were two serious crashes during the run,, in which 13 riders fell, including Op-p-arman ami .Bidot. At the end of the three stages Mnuolair was leading, followed by Bidot, Oppernmn and Lamb. The French team heads the teams’ chrunpionship aggregate.
